你查询的IP:[124.64.143.203]  地理位置:中国–北京–北京

最新查询119.232.244.82 116.248.253.98 116.194.26.233 218.152.236.54 210.15.107.177 218.100.32.199 211.136.139.173 211.64.168.19 124.160.65.213 124.64.143.203 122.4.201.248 124.88.207.117 121.52.208.137 203.174.7.209 218.185.192.200 210.56.192.31 59.172.55.35 202.38.176.46 117.53.48.115 119.58.1.117 202.141.160.62 202.38.176.152 58.99.128.105 202.43.144.203 118.67.112.13 119.164.97.239 203.191.64.233 124.249.251.217 202.136.48.129 202.41.152.67 202.127.40.164